Important sections of FEAT include Reasoning and Verbal Ability. These two sections have the most weightage of marks. Out of 140 marks, these two sections compile to fetch 90 marks. However, each section of FEAT exam is important as each section will fetch marks. Candidates will be shortlisted based on their overall performance. FLAME University does not consioder section wise marks to shortlist candidates for admissions.

FLAME University conducts the FLAME Entrance Aptitude Test (FEAT) for admissions into its Bachelor of Arts (BA), Bachelor of Science (BSc), Bachelor of Business Administration (BBA), and BBA Communications Management programs. In addition to FEAT, applicants can also seek admission through valid SAT or ACT scores. The FEAT exam is administered online in multiple cycles, and eligibility criteria require candidates to have completed Class 12.

No, Jindal School of Environment and Sustainability is not more expensive than FLAME University. The total tuition fees for both B.A. and B.Sc. courses (1 branch each) in Jindal School of Environment and Sustainability is INR 9 Lacs whereas the total tuition fees of B.Sc. course (1 branch) at FLAME University is INR 22.2 Lacs and the total fees of B.A. course (2 branches) at FLAME University ranges between INR 22.2 Lacs and INR 29.6 lakhs. Therefore in terms of fees FLAME University is a lot more expensive than Jindal School of Environment and Sustainability.
